E.J.BELLIE, V.S.KANDASAMY
JAYALAKSHMI TRANSPORT (REGD. ) – Appellant
Versus
MILL STORE (MADRAS) PVT. LTD. – Respondent


Counsel for the parties :
For the Appellant : Tr. T.S. Gopalan & Co.
For the Respondent:M/s. P. Gopalan, Advocates.

ORDER

Thiru Justice E.J. Bellie, President—Opposing the order of the District Forum against them the opposite party Sri Jayalakshmi Transport has filed this appeal.

2. The complaint was filed against the opposite party alleging that the Dhanalakshmi Mill Stores, Madras sent a consignment of 37 Huller Cylinders through the opposite party to be delivered to the complainant M/s. Mill Stores (Madras) Pvt. Ltd., Tiruchy. But since the goods were found defective and unmerchantable, the complainant did not take delivery and therefore the opposite party took back the consignment to deliver it to the consignor at Madras. But it did not do so. Because of this lapse on the part of the opposite party, on pressure from the consignor the complainant had to pay the value of the consignment namely Rs. 3,700/-. Besides, the complainant has incurred a sum of Rs. 300/- as incidental charges. The opposite party is liable to pay these amounts to tine complainants. The opposite party is further liable to pay other damages. On these grounds the complaint has been filed for an award.
